Versatile Ajax defender Davinson Sanchez emerges as a rumoured transfer target for Tottenham Hotspur, who are reportedly keen to make him their first summer signing.

Tottenham Hotspur boss Mauricio Pochettino has reportedly targeted young Ajax defender Davinson Sanchez as his first summer signing.

The 21-year-old, voted the Dutch club's Player of the Season in 2016-17, has been valued by sporting director Marc Overmars at £35m.

Crystal Palace, now under the management of former Ajax boss Frank de Boer, are said to have recently shown an interest in the versatile centre-back, while Barcelona and Chelsea have also been linked in the past.

According to The Sun, Pochettino hopes to bring Sanchez on board to get the ball rolling in terms of incoming activity, having so far failed to sign a single player during the off-season.

Sanchez made 45 appearances for Ajax in all competitions last time out, including the full 90 minutes of the Europa League final defeat to Manchester United in May.
